Thomas Fishlock was born about 1788 in East Kennet and died about 1851 in Marshfield, Gloucestershire.   In between times he married Sarah Snell, born about 1787 in Castle Coombe, and fathered 6 children all born in Marshfield.   
I would appreciate any information on the Wiltshire families and/or forebears of Thomas Fishlock and Sarah Snell.   Were they really Moonrakers!

Hi Dave!

The International Genealogical Index shows that a Sarah Snell
was christened on 2nd Nov 1783 at Castlecomb, Wilts the daughter
of Francis Snell and Hannah.

Francis Snell married Hannah Brown on 11th October 1778 at
Corsham, Wilts and, in addition to Sarah, the IGI shows that they
had 2 other children:

Hester         Christened on 7th Aug 1785 at Castlecomb
Hannah       Christened on17th Feb 1788 at Castlecomb

Hope this is the family you are looking for.

There is a grave at Hilperton Parish Churh, Trobridge...
GEORGE FISHLOCK died 15/9/1896 Aged 60.
Kate his daughter died 8/1/1885 aged 17
Jane his wife died 16/12/1909 aged 65.

Are these yours?
